The Boh Tea Plantation: A Historical Gem
Founded in 1929, the Boh Tea Plantation is the largest tea producer in Malaysia and has played a significant role in shaping the local tea culture. The estate was established by J.A. Russell, a British planter who recognized the potential of the Cameron Highlands for tea cultivation. Today, Boh Tea is synonymous with quality, and its products are enjoyed both locally and internationally.
The plantation not only contributes to the economy but also serves as a cultural landmark, showcasing the colonial influences in its architecture and landscape. The Art of Tea: Boh Tea Factory Tour
No visit to the Boh Tea Plantation is complete without a tour of the Boh Tea Factory. Here, you’ll witness the entire tea production process, from withering the leaves to the final packaging. The factory is equipped with modern machinery that complements traditional methods, ensuring that each batch of tea is of the highest quality.

Outdoor Adventures: Beyond the Tea Plantation
While the Boh Tea Plantation is a highlight of the Cameron Highlands, the region offers a plethora of outdoor activities for adventure seekers. Hiking enthusiasts will be thrilled with the numerous trails available, ranging from easy walks to challenging hikes.
One popular trail is the hike to Gunung Brinchang, the highest peak in the Cameron Highlands. The trek offers stunning views and a chance to explore the unique flora and fauna of the region. Don’t forget to check out the mossy forest along the way, a magical place that feels like stepping into another world!
If you’re looking for something a bit more relaxed, consider a leisurely stroll through the beautiful gardens, like the Rose Garden or the Butterfly Garden, where you can enjoy the vibrant colors and the serene atmosphere.

Practical Information for Travelers: Tips and Tricks
Before you set off on your adventure to the Boh Tea Plantation, here are a few practical tips to make your visit even smoother:
- Opening Hours: The Boh Tea Centre is typically open from 9 AM to 5 PM, but it’s always good to check ahead for any changes.
- Transportation: While guided tours are popular, renting a car gives you the freedom to explore at your own pace. Just be cautious on the winding roads!
- Dress Comfortably: Wear comfortable shoes for walking and be prepared for cooler temperatures, especially in the mornings and evenings.
